Pakistan’s youth can excel in sports with govt’s patronage: Hamza Khan

Junior World Squash Champion Muhammad Hamza Khan says Pakistan’s youth has great talent and potential in games and can excel in sports with the patronage of the government.

In an exclusive interview with Planet FM 87.6 Radio Pakistan Islamabad today, he said his victory at the Junior World Squash Championship is a significant achievement for Pakistan in last 36 years.

Muhammad Hamza Khan said he attributed his victory to his parents, coach and the prayers of the entire nation.

He also visited different studios of Radio Pakistan and commended the facilities of modern broadcasting.

Director General Radio Pakistan Muhammad Tahir Hassan presented Muhammad Hamza Khan a souvenir.
